Chinese dream stone with poetic inscription: The snow and the moon reflect light back to each other, 19th century

Painting, 38 x 1 cm.
Materials: Chinese Dali marble, highlighted with black ink, ornamental plate for chair or screen

Collection: Musée national des arts asiatiques – Musée Guimet, Paris (Inv. no. ICHT 268a).

In the Musée Guimet, in Paris, Verheyen and Dani

Franque particularly admire the traditional Chinese

monochrome ceramics and paintings. Verheyen

explains: ‘My orientation towards the inner and to

Chinese art comes from ceramics and porcelain, of

which the monochromes are the high point. Both in

my ceramics and in my paintings I tried to achieve

a kind of essence that is beyond the formal.’

This Chinese dream stone also comes

from the Musée Guimet. The circular, lunar shape

and the title point towards Verheyen’s later works.
